Dieter Wilhelm wrote:
By the way, what is confusing to me is the fact that the diff output
does not reflect the indentation of the code correctly.  Please have a
look at the progn command, in the code the lines below progn are
indented with 2 additional spaces.

Such visual distortions arise due to tabs in the code, which is the
default (see indent-tabs-mode).  Each line of the diff output starts
with 2 additional characters (<, >, +, -, or !, then a space); that may
or may not result in the subsequent printable characters being displayed
2 columns to the right, depending on whether any intervening tabs get
pushed past the next (8-column) tab stop.

I know it's disconcerting, but you just have to learn to ignore it.
